What's Really Happening on Wall Street?
USC Dornsife College of Letters, Arts and Sciences

Friday, October 3, 2008 : 12:30pm to 2:00pm
University Park Campus
Taper Hall of Humanities
202
Free
AP Photo
Confused about the national economic crisis? USC experts explain what’s happened, why, and what Congress is trying to do about it.
Moderator
Simon Wilkie, professor and chair of Economics, is co-director for the Center in Law, Economics, and Organization.
Panelists Robert Dekle, professor of Economics, studies international finance, open-economy and development. Yong Kim, assistant professor of Economics, researches applied macroeconomic theory, including the housing market. Michael Magill, professor of Economics, researches the economics of financial markets and the economics of uncertainty.Presented by the USC College of Letters, Arts & Sciences Department of Economics and the Office of Academic Programs' Series on Current Events.
